Some people swear in high school as a way to fit in with peers or express their identity, often viewing it as a sign of rebellion or maturity. It can also serve as a means of coping with stress or strong emotions, providing an outlet for frustration or anger. Additionally, exposure to media and cultural influences can normalize swearing, making it seem more acceptable in social settings. Ultimately, it reflects a combination of social dynamics and personal expression during a formative period of adolescence.
